At WWDC 2026, Apple finally revealed the long-promised advanced Siri, a significant overhaul resulting from intensive collaboration with Google. This new Siri utilizes foundational models co-developed with Google, distinct from the Gemini app, ensuring a purely Apple user experience.
Federighi detailed how Apple's system orchestrator interacts with new models like AFM Core (20 billion parameters) and cloud-based AFM Cloud Pro and ADM Cloud. A key innovation is the 'scarce model' approach, reducing parameter loading for improved efficiency on-device.
The cloud infrastructure is a notable evolution, extending Apple's Private Cloud Compute to third-party servers. This secure environment now operates on Nvidia and Google infrastructure, integrating Nvidia GPUs and security components from Intel and Google to support the most powerful models.
This rebuilt Siri represents a strategic fusion of Apple's vision with Google's advanced generative AI capabilities, delivering the intelligent, contextual assistant Apple customers expect.
